Subdivision 1. Member contributions. A member of the plan shall make an employee contribution in an amount equal to 6.83 percent of salary.
Subd. 2. Employer contributions. The employer shall contribute for a member of the plan an amount equal to 10.25 percent of salary.
Subd. 3. Contribution deductions. The head of each department of each governmental subdivision that employs members of the local government correctional service retirement plan must deduct employee contributions in the manner and subject to the terms provided insection 353.27, subdivision 4.
